QA Engineer

QA Engineer
Ritual, United States

Experience
1 Year
Salary
0 - 0
Job Type
Job Shift
Job Category
Traveling
No
Career Level
Telecommute
No
Qualification
As mentioned in job details
Total Vacancies
1 Job
Posted on
Feb 20, 2021
Last Date
Mar 20, 2021
Location(s)

Job Description

Position: QA EngineerReports to: QA LeadLocation: Onsite/Culver City (remote through pandemic)

EssentialWe’re hiring a QA Engineer to join our small and fast growing digital product team to support testing new features in development while monitoring and maintaining existing features across our technology stack. In this role, you’ll work alongside product managers and engineers to ensure code is tested thoroughly in the development process and deployed with a high level of confidence. You’ll also help develop, implement, and maintain our end-to-end test suite in mabl, and work with our customer experience team to triage and resolve customer-facing issues.
We believe that great digital experiences are an important part of any company’s success, and we think you'll agree. As a subscription service, we help our customers better invest in the products they’ve subscribed to, by reinforcing the habits that help them in their long-term mission. You’ll be part of a strong digital product team of designers, product managers, and data analysts to continuously ensure our customers have the best possible experience on our site.What You'll Do:
  • Work with engineers and product managers to validate user requirements and identify potential risk or gaps.
  • Document testing steps and conduct deep-dive manual testing on both front- and back-end code using dev tools such as Paw and Postico.
  • Create and maintain automated tests and uptime monitors across multiple environments using our automated testing platform mabl.
  • Assist our customer support team with triaging and resolving technical account issues that users may encounter, and escalate critical issues when necessary.
  • Assist with incident management and monitoring of critical systems, and create documentation that empowers developers and other stakeholders to test their code effectively.
  • Work with other departments to ensure changes to our software integrations are robust and well-tested.
Our Stack:
  • Our homepage (marketing pages) use React, Gatsby, GraphQL, and Contentful.
  • Our checkout + account experiences use EmberJS.Our back-end is a Rails API that handles everything from account creation and payments, all the way through to fulfillment.
  • See more here: https://stackshare.io/ritual-com/ritual
  • Integrations: Contentful, Segment, FullStory, Bugsnag, LaunchDarkly, Stripe, SendGrid, Cloudflare, JustUno, Iterable, Zendesk/Kustomer
Who You Are:
  • Passionate. You put yourself in the shoes of our customers to test through a customer-centric lens. You’re not okay with good enough and work to ensure that our customers' high expectations are met when visiting our site or interacting with our brand.
  • Well-Rounded. You stay on top of evolving QA best practices and processes and aren’t afraid to propose a change when you see value in doing something differently. You have experience with both manual and automated testing, and can optimize an end-to-end test for speed and coverage.
  • Detail-Oriented. You don’t take requirements at face value and can identify second- and third-order effects of proposed changes. You notice design differences down to the pixel and think across all possible abstractions when posed with a bug.
  • Problem Solver. You’re able to troubleshoot hard-to-reproduce problems by thinking outside the box and using the right tools. When faced with a roadblock, you double-down and dive even deeper to find the root cause. When you find an unconventional way to make something work, you document it and distribute it to the broader team.
  • Analytical. You can make a case for prioritizing bugs, planned work, and customer issues, and back it up with data and context. You’re not afraid to ask questions and raise concerns, and use all available data to arrive at a conclusion.
  • Cross-Functional. Whether it be a design change, a new API endpoint, or a fresh integration, you can jump in and test pixels, payloads, and performance. You enjoy collaborating with engineers and empower them to test their code effectively.
  • Expert communicator. You’re able to run with customer feedback and elaborate on the end-user impact to the engineering team. Conversely, you can effectively distill and explain technical concepts to non-technical audiences.
What You’ll Need:
  • Education: BS in Computer Science or other engineering/technical field preferred. Equivalent experience also accepted.
  • Experience: 3+ years of testing experience in

Job Specification

Job Rewards and Benefits

Ritual

Information Technology and Services - Kingston, Canada
© Copyright 2004-2024 Mustakbil.com All Right Reserved.